About Kanako Yamamoto
Kanako Yamamoto is a scholar working on Radiological and Ultrasound Technology, Biochemistry and Public Health, Environmental and Occupational Health, having authored 29 papers that have together received 328 indexed citations. Recurring topics across this work include Palliative Care and End-of-Life Issues (9 papers), Family and Patient Care in Intensive Care Units (8 papers), Hormonal Regulation and Hypertension (3 papers), Antioxidant Activity and Oxidative Stress (3 papers), Molecular Sensors and Ion Detection (2 papers), Childhood Cancer Survivors' Quality of Life (2 papers), Microplastics and Plastic Pollution (2 papers) and Pleural and Pulmonary Diseases (2 papers). The work is most often cited by research in Soil Science (60 citations), Industrial and Manufacturing Engineering (44 citations) and Radiological and Ultrasound Technology (25 citations). Kanako Yamamoto has collaborated with scholars based in Japan and United States. Frequent co-authors include Kazuo Miyashita, Masami Fukushima, Takeshi Komai, Shigeru Ueda, Toshihiro Aramaki, Mitsuo Yamamoto, Tsuyoshi Murakami, Kazuhiro Nakayama, Eiichi Kotake‐Nara and Yuki Yonekura.
